        private EntityOperationResult UpdateInternal(EntityUpdate update)
        {
            if (!RunInspection(update))
            {
                return(EntityOperationResult.FailResult(new EntityOperationError("Insufficient rights to perform this operation.", EntityOperationError.ACCESS_VIOLATION)));
            }

            EntityOperationContext ctx = new EntityOperationContext();

            this.AppyLogicBefore(update, ctx);

            var entity = update.ToEntity();
            EntityOperationResult result = null;
            bool created = false;

            try
            {
                if (update.Id.HasValue)
                {
                    if (update.PropertyUpdates.Count > 0)
                    {
                        _repository.Update(entity);
                    }
                }
                else
                {
                    update.Id = _repository.Create(entity);
                    created   = true;
                }

                //Order by operation - process detach first
                foreach (var relUpdate in update.RelationUpdates.OrderByDescending(ru => ru.Operation))
                {
                    if (relUpdate.Operation == RelationOperation.Attach)
                    {
                        _repository.Attach(entity, relUpdate.ToRelation());
                    }
                    else if (relUpdate.Operation == RelationOperation.Detach)
                    {
                        _repository.Detach(entity, relUpdate.ToRelation());
                    }
                    else if (relUpdate.PropertyUpdates.Count > 0)
                    {
                        _repository.UpdateRelation(entity, relUpdate.ToRelation());
                    }
                }

                result = EntityOperationResult.SuccessResult();
                if (created)
                {
                    result.Data.Add("Created", update.Id.Value);
                }
            }
            catch (UniqueRuleViolationException rex)
            {
                result = EntityOperationResult.FailResult(new EntityOperationError(rex.Message, EntityOperationError.UNIQUE_RULE_VIOLATION));
            }
            this.AppyLogicAfter(update, ctx, result);
            return(result);
        }

        //[TestMethod]
        public void Test_EntityRepo_Perf()
        {
            var r = new Random();
            var dbService = new TestDatabaseService();
            var repository = new EntityRepository(dms, dbService, new SequenceProvider(dbService));
            using (var ctx = dbService.GetDatabaseContext(true))
            {
                for (int i = 0; i < 1000; i++)
                {
                    EntityUpdate update = new EntityUpdate("author");
                    update.Set("firstname", "Robert" + i);
                    update.Set("lastname", "Jordan");
                    update.Set("isalive", false);
                    update.Set("Born", new DateTime(1948, 10, 17));
                    update.Set("Rating", 5.5m + r.Next(4));
                    var id = repository.Create(update.ToEntity());
                    Assert.IsTrue(id > 0);

                    EntityQuery2 q = new EntityQuery2("author", id);
                    q.AddProperties("FirstName", "lastname", "isalive", "born", "rating");
                    var e = repository.Read(q);
                    foreach (var pu in update.PropertyUpdates)
                    {
                        Assert.AreEqual(pu.Value, e.Data[pu.Key]);
                    }

                    EntityUpdate update2 = new EntityUpdate(e.Name, e.Id);
                    update2.Set("rating", 5.5m + r.Next(4));
                    update2.Set("lastname", e.Data["lastname"] + "_EDIT");

                    repository.Update(update2.ToEntity());
                    e = repository.Read(q);
                    foreach (var pu in update2.PropertyUpdates)
                    {
                        Assert.AreEqual(pu.Value, e.Data[pu.Key]);
                    }
                    foreach (var pu in update.PropertyUpdates)
                    {
                        if (!pu.Key.Equals("rating", StringComparison.InvariantCultureIgnoreCase) && !pu.Key.Equals("lastname", StringComparison.InvariantCultureIgnoreCase))
                            Assert.AreEqual(pu.Value, e.Data[pu.Key]);
                    }

                }

                ctx.Complete();
            }

            using (var ctx = dbService.GetDatabaseContext(true))
            {
                var qAll = new EntityQuery2("Author");
                var all = repository.Search(qAll);
                Assert.AreEqual(1000, all.Count());
                foreach (var a in all)
                    repository.Delete(a);
                Assert.AreEqual(0, repository.Search(qAll).Count());
            }
        }
